Senate struggles on final passage of $1.7 trillion spending bill

Por: CBS News Politics December 22, 2022

thumbnail

Washington — The Senate on Wednesday pushed off voting on final passage of the , as lawmakers scramble to clear the package swiftly to stave off a partial government shutdown just before the Christmas holiday, and leave Washington ahead of the approaching winter storm.Republican Minority Whip Sen. John Thune said Wednesday night there would not be a vote that night. Thune and other Senate Republicans said the bill was being held up by an issue... + full article
